Going on a road trip with a toddler can be a daunting task, especially when it comes to keeping them entertained. The Pop Fidget Ball is an excellent sensory toy that not only captivates your child's attention but also provides stress relief for parents during long drives. This lightweight and easy-to-handle toy encourages tactile exploration, making it a favorite for many toddlers. If your child loves sound, consider the colorful remote control car keys, which offer an interactive experience but be mindful of the volume, as it can get quite loud. Sensory shape toys are also beneficial, promoting cognitive development and problem-solving skills as toddlers engage with different shapes and textures. Lastly, Leap Frog's learning books are another fantastic option for introducing language skills in a fun way. They’re great for budding readers eager to learn.
